On Thursday, 6 June 2024, in the evening at 22:35, in Vilnius, on Aušros Vartų street near No. 15, a Citroen C5 hit a pedestrian away from any crossing. Two people were injured — a 21-year-old pedestrian (treated as an outpatient) and a 22-year-old pedestrian (treated as an outpatient). The accident was caused by the 52-year-old driver of the Citroen (33 years of driving experience), who failed to keep a safe distance. The driver was sober. At the time of the accident it was twilight, the weather was clear, the road surface was dry. The speed limit on this section is 40 km/h.
